About The Position

The Core Applications Engineering team is seeking an Applications Engineer 3 to manage large-scale automation projects, provide technical consultation, and lead proposal development. This role involves collaborating with sales and cross-functional teams, mentoring junior engineers, and ensuring customer satisfaction throughout the project lifecycle. The Client Experience Management (CXM) aspect includes managing pre-sale activities like proposal generation and technical support, as well as post-sale responsibilities such as leading client meetings, managing change orders, and ensuring project delivery. The goal is to provide a seamless client experience from initial engagement through post-delivery follow-up, while also identifying opportunities for account expansion.
